Output ef29041563bc2163dcffc09c233ef1efa039fee74a2bb90829879c4210e795a2:0
- value
- 1298263
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5fb81fc73a20c224b88dfc8621c2d2358472c37
- address
- bc1quhacrlrn5gxzyjugmlyxy8pdydvywtphuu9e4h
- transaction
- ef29041563bc2163dcffc09c233ef1efa039fee74a2bb90829879c4210e795a2
- confirmations
- 37
- spent
- false